5. China and Mongolia

Border: City of Erenhot/Dinosaurs

Area: 4,677 km²

Estimated Gross Domestic Product: $17.52 trillion (China) / $43 billion (Mongolia)

Erenhot, a Chinese border city, and its Mongolian neighbor share a prehistoric legacy celebrated through towering dinosaur statues. Famous for its fossil fields, Erenhot embraces this ancient connection with an impressive dinosaur archway at its entrance.

This landmark symbolizes the shared natural history of both nations, welcoming visitors and reminding them of a time before modern borders existed.

 

Beyond honoring a shared past, the dinosaur arch also marks the real border between China and Mongolia. These massive sculptures turn the crossing into a journey through time, blending history and geography.

As travelers approach, they are greeted by these awe-inspiring creatures, sparking wonder and nostalgia for a distant era. This unique border highlights the connections that transcend today’s political divides.
